This appraisal method is now largely in use throughout the world. It requires performance feedback from all important stakeholders of the organization, such as the ratee himself, his superiors, peers, other team members, customers, and suppliers. Apart from its effectiveness in reporting performance, this method also ensures total employee involvement (TEI) and employee empowerment. It reduces the error of a subjective evaluation system in an organization.
